Consider the following statements:1. Biofilms can form on medical implants within human tissues.2. Biofilms can form on food and food processing surfaces.3. Biofilms can exhibit antibiotic resistance.Which of the statements given above are correct?
✓ Correct answer: d) 1, 2 and 3
ExplanationA biofilm is a collection of microbial cells that are encased in a polysaccharide-based matrix and are permanently attached to a surface (i.e., cannot be removed by gentle rinsing).Microorganisms that form biofilms include bacteria, fungi, and protists.Noncellular materials such as mineral crystals, corrosion particles, clay or silt particles, or blood components, depending on the environment in which the biofilm has developed, may also be found in the biofilm matrix.Statement 1 is correct: Biofilms may form on a wide variety of surfaces, including living tissues, food and food processing surfaces, indwelling medical devices (devices in the body like catheters, heart valves), human and animal tissue, industrial or potable water system piping, or natural aquatic systems.Statement 2 is correct: Biofilms are a significant concern in the food industry, forming on surfaces such as cutting boards, conveyor belts, and food packaging equipment.Contaminated biofilms can lead to foodborne illnesses caused by pathogens like Listeria monocytogenes, Salmonella, and Escherichia coli.Statemen
